What role have books played in my exploration of wine regions around the world? What's it like tasting ultra high-end wine? How is wine portrayed in literature? Today we're talking about all that and more in a behind-the-scenes peek at Red, White and Drunk All Over. Today's show is a little different from the usual. I’m excited to share this episode from the Behind the Bookshelves podcast, where I was interviewed by Richard Davies. Richard has kindly given me permission to include this interview on my show for you. If you love books as much as I do, be sure to check out his podcast where he features interviews with authors about their books and related topics.
